Introduction to Canvas
Canvas is a cloud-based LMS that allows instructors to create and manage online courses, assignments, and grade books. It provides a user-friendly interface for students to access course materials, submit assignments, and participate in discussions. With Canvas, instructors can create a personalized learning environment that fosters engagement, collaboration, and academic success.
Navigating the Canvas Dashboard
The Canvas dashboard is the central hub for accessing courses, assignments, and other resources. To navigate the dashboard, follow these steps:
- Log in to your Canvas account using your Cerritos College username and password
- Click on the “Courses” tab to view a list of your enrolled courses
- Click on a course to access its dashboard, where you can view assignments, announcements, and other course materials
Canvas Feature | Description |
---|---|
Modules | Organize course content into modules, making it easy to navigate and access materials |
Assignments | Create and submit assignments, quizzes, and discussions, with options for grading and feedback |
Discussions | Participate in online discussions, allowing for collaboration and engagement with peers and instructors |

How do I access my Canvas courses?
+To access your Canvas courses, log in to your Cerritos College account and click on the “Courses” tab. From there, you can view a list of your enrolled courses and access their dashboards.
What if I need help with Canvas?
+If you need help with Canvas, you can contact the Cerritos College support team through the Canvas help menu or by visiting the college’s website. You can also access Canvas tutorials and FAQs for troubleshooting common issues.
Can I use Canvas on my mobile device?
+Yes, you can access Canvas on your mobile device using the Canvas app, available for iOS and Android devices. The app allows you to view courses, submit assignments, and participate in discussions on-the-go.
